Innovating the Future: UTM and GFM Forge Strategic Alliance to Redefine Facilities Management

JOHOR BAHRU, 25th July – Universiti Teknologi Malaysia (UTM) and Global Facilities Management Sdn. Bhd. (GFM) have taken a significant stride towards fostering collaborative academic development, knowledge exchanges, and joint research projects by formalizing their strategic partnership through the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) today.

The MoU signing marks a momentous occasion, solidifying the commitment of both esteemed organizations to engage in various areas of collaboration, including academic development and research enhancement, internship and industry attachment, professional programs and seminars, collaborative teaching activities, research and publication, and product commercialization.

The distinguished ceremony saw the MoU being signed by UTM’s Deputy Vice-Chancellor (Research and Innovation), Prof. Dr. Rosli Md Illias and the Non-Independent Non-Executive Director of GFM, Tuan Haji Mohammad Shahrizal Mohammad Idris.

Esteemed dignitaries, including Deputy Vice-Chancellor (Academic and International), Prof. Dr. Hishamuddin Mohd Ali; Dean, Faculty of Built Environment and Surveying, Prof. Dr. Sr Dr. Kherun Nita Ali; Chair of Business Management Division, Department of Deputy Vice-Chancellor (Development), Prof. Dr. Maimunah Sapri, and Director of the Centre for Real Estate Studies (CRES), Sr. Dr. Nurul Hana Adi Maimun, graced the event as witnesses.

“I am very pleased to witness the commitment of UTM and GFM to establish a closer collaboration and ties in the joint research program, teaching, consultation, knowledge transfer and community engagement, eventually lead to scholarly excellence in asset and facilities management,” said Prof. Rosli in his speech.

“We need the expertise of UTM researchers to structure the way of thinking and identify the potential of new technology to move forward in managing resources, ensuring effective assets and facilities management. UTM and GFM are enthusiastic about the boundless possibilities that lie ahead and are fully committed to exploring additional avenues of cooperation for mutual benefit in the future,” expressed Haji Mohammad Shahrizal.

The strategic partnership between UTM and GFM holds immense promise in advancing research, promoting academic excellence, and driving innovation in the field of facilities management.

Together, they aim to redefine the boundaries of facilities management and set new standards of excellence, leaving a lasting impact on the industry and the community at large.

Leveraging GFM’s two decades of experience as one of Malaysia’s premier facilities management service providers, coupled with their adherence to international quality management standards, this collaboration is poised to substantially impact academic and industry landscapes.
